Steve,
Unless you are finding that something doesn't work correctly, the error can likely be ignored. As for the cause, it may be related to bug 10186820 which is not fixed until version 11. One other point, remember that Developer Suite is inteneded for design-time, single user, local use only. So if you are accessing this OC4J instance from a remote client, this is not what it was intended for.
Regarding your question about "lservlet" or Listener Servlet, lservlet is the Forms Listener Servlet which is part of the complete "Forms Servlet". Both the "Forms Servlet" and "Forms Listener Servlet" are included in frmsrv.jar. We reference and alias the Servlets in web.xml (for Forms 10).
Remember that it is the Forms Servlet (frmservlet) that is responsible for generating the html which eventually causes the client applet to start. It is the ListenerServlet (lservlet) that does all the work after the applet has started.

    After you interrupt the application deployment and before trying to deploy it again :
    - Check if OC4J config files (server.xml and default-web-site.xml) contains the failed application information
    - Check if DCM repository has failed application information (use dcmctl listapplications, or via EM)
    If these two are out of sync, you might want to create a TAR, so support analyst can help you further diagnose the problem.

    You should check your shared_pool_size and java_pool_size
    parameters on the database.
    This error occurs when these are not set high enough.
    Increase their size and restart the db and try the
    mapviewer again.

    Hi,
    I remember this as an issue in Unix and it was recommended simply to use the Unix kill command to stop the standalone OC4J.
    Also, metalink document 1312743.1 provides this syntax:
    java -jar OracleBI_HOME/oc4j_bi/j2ee/home/admin.jar ormi://localhost:23791 oc4jadmin <oc4jadmin password> -shutdown force
    where <oc4jadmin password> is the password for the oc4jadmin user.
    The syntax above works well on Windows. On Linux it generates the reported error.
    If affected, try one of the following alternate syntax options. The first excludes the host name and port from the ormi argument. The second includes the IPV4 option.
    java -jar /OracleBI/oc4j_bi/j2ee/home/admin.jar ormi:// oc4jadmin <oc4jadmin password> -shutdown force
    java -Djava.net.preferIPv4Stack=true -jar /OracleBI/oc4j_bi/j2ee/home/admin.jar ormi://localhost:23791 oc4jadmin <oc4jadmin password> -shutdown force
